Resurfacing Your Car Park: Costs & Considerations

Resurfacing your car park can be a considerable investment, and understanding the related costs is essential. Elements influencing the overall price include the area of the space , the current condition, and the selected materials. Typically , asphalt resurfacing will cost between $3 and $8 per square foot , but concrete options can be considerably expensive. Consider to factor in groundwork work, which may include removing the old surface and grading the sub-base. Lastly , you should secure multiple quotes to contrast pricing and guarantee you’re getting the most competitive value for your budget.

Durable Car Park Surfaces: Choosing the Right Resurfacing Option

Selecting the appropriate surface for car park resurfacing is critical for lasting performance . Assess the volume of vehicle flow and environmental factors – heavy loads require robust solutions like asphalt overlay , while reduced usage may accommodate polymer-modified concrete or a stylish epoxy finish . Proper water removal is also absolutely necessary to avoid breakdown and guarantee a safe driving experience for any users .

Parking Area Resurfacing: Typical Issues & How to Steer Clear Of Them

When planning parking lot resurfacing, several potential challenges can arise . Inadequate surface preparation is a major culprit, often leading to premature breakdown and costly repairs. Poor drainage, enabling water penetration , can harm the new surface and base. Furthermore, selecting inappropriate asphalt for the typical pedestrian intensity and conditions can result in premature degradation. To circumvent these pitfalls , it's essential to undertake a detailed site evaluation , employ experienced contractors , and choose robust asphalt products that are specifically suited to the site and its requirements. Finally, sufficient curing time is imperative for the durability of the resurfaced parking lot.
